Step-by-Step Guide to Build Your Shopify Food & Beverage Store

Building your Shopify store doesn’t have to be complicated. As a freelance Shopify developer, I often guide brands through a step-by-step process that keeps things simple, organized, and conversion-focused. Here’s how I usually do it:

Start by creating an account on Shopify. You’ll need your store name, email, and password. Once you’re in, your dashboard becomes the control center for your entire website design and development process.

Your theme sets the first impression for your brand. Shopify offers both free and premium options, so pick one that showcases your food and beverage products beautifully. With custom Shopify development, you can tweak the theme to match your brand colors, fonts, and visual style.

Go to Products > Add Product and start filling in the details:

  • Upload high-quality images (lifestyle shots work wonders!)
  • Write descriptive product names and clear dietary info
  • Include pricing and any special attributes (size, flavor, packaging)
  • Use tags for filters and organize items into collections

This ensures your customers can easily browse and find exactly what they want.

Smooth checkout is crucial. Shopify supports Shopify Payments, PayPal, and many other gateways. Setting this up correctly ensures your customers can pay with confidence and keeps your store secure—a must for any e-commerce website design.

Collections make your store easier to navigate. Create categories like snacks, beverages, fresh produce, or meal kits. Then, add them to your navigation menu so shoppers can explore your offerings intuitively.

Here’s where your store really starts to feel like yours:

  • Edit theme settings to adjust colors, fonts, and layout
  • Upload your logo for instant branding recognition
  • Create essential pages like About Us, Contact, and FAQ
  • With custom Shopify development, you can add interactive features like product finders or recipe suggestions

Decide on shipping methods, rates, and delivery times. If you’re selling perishable items, include freshness guarantees or temperature info. Shopify lets you configure local delivery, subscriptions, and even pre-order options.

Before you go live, place test orders, check mobile responsiveness, and get feedback from friends or early customers. This step ensures your website design and development is polished and ready for real traffic.

Once everything looks perfect, remove your store password and open your doors to the world. Celebrate—it’s time to welcome your first customers!

Common Challenges and How to Solve Them

Running a food and beverage Shopify store comes with its fair share of hurdles, but don’t worry—I’ve helped many brands navigate these challenges with practical solutions. Here’s what you should know:

Logistics & Shipping

Delivering perishable items can be tricky. You’ll want to partner with specialized food delivery services and consider temperature-controlled shipping. As a freelance Shopify developer, I can help integrate shipping apps and set delivery options so your customers always get fresh products.

Inventory Management

Running out of stock—or worse, selling expired items—is a nightmare. Shopify’s real-time inventory tracking, combined with batch expiry apps, keeps everything organized. I often set up dashboards for easy monitoring so you can focus on growing your brand instead of chasing stock.

POS Integration

If you also sell offline, Shopify POS can be customized to match your physical store setup. You can sync inventory, manage receipts, and even print kitchen tickets for your staff. I make sure custom Shopify development aligns both online and offline operations seamlessly.

Customer Experience

Your online shoppers can’t taste your products, so visuals and storytelling matter more than ever. High-quality photos, engaging videos, and detailed ingredient narratives build trust and increase sales. When I handle Shopify store design, I focus on creating immersive experiences that make your visitors feel connected to your brand.
